Here&#8217;s a brief overview of each qualification to help you make an informed decision<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: center;\">ACCA (Association of Chartered Certified Accountants)<\/h3>\n<p>ACCA is a globally recognized qualification that focuses on developing accounting, auditing, and financial management skills. It offers a comprehensive understanding of<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Financial reporting<\/li>\n<li>Taxation<\/li>\n<li>Audit<\/li>\n<li>Business strategy<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>It is suitable for individuals who intend to pursue a career in accounting, finance, or auditing. \u00a0Its a UK certification of a Global CA equivalent. There are a total of 14 papers to clear. However, if you are from a particular University in India from which you are graduating, you also have an option of exemptions in those papers.<\/p>\n<p>For example, if you are pursuing your graduation from Delhi university, you have option of 4 exemptions of ACCA exams For the CA fraternity, 9 papers are exempt. This degree involves a combination of academic studies, professional training, and passing rigorous examinations of CA inter and CA finals. \u00a0CAs are skilled in areas such as<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Accounting<\/li>\n<li>Auditing<\/li>\n<li>Taxation<\/li>\n<li>Financial management.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>You can pursue CA inter and once you clear CA inter, then you are supposed to go for 3 years of exhaustive article ship under a designated Chartered Accountant. Once the articleship period is over, then the candidate can go for the final examinations. Unlike ACCA wherein you can give 1 exam at a time, in case you have to give at least one group at a time<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: center;\">CFA (Chartered Financial Analyst)<\/h3>\n<p>The CFA designation is focused on investment analysis and portfolio management. It is a globally recognized qualification for professionals working in the investment industry. The CFA program covers a broad range of topics, including<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Economics<\/li>\n<li>Ethics<\/li>\n<li>Financial analysis<\/li>\n<li>Portfolio management<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>If you are interested in finance, investment analysis, or asset management, CFA could be a suitable choice. It has 3 Levels, Level I, Level II and Level III.\u00a0 You have to clear the exam level wise. Once you complete all three levels, you need to have a minimum work experience of 4 years to get your CFA charter.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: center;\">FRM (Financial Risk Manager)<\/h3>\n<p>FRM is a professional certification that emphasizes risk management in the financial industry. It covers topics such as<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Financial markets<\/li>\n<li>Risk measurement and management<\/li>\n<li>Investment management<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>If you have a keen interest in risk analysis and management within the finance sector, pursuing FRM could be a viable option.\u00a0 It has 2 Levels, Level I and Level II. One best thing with FRM is that you can also give both Levels of FRM in a single shot. You can get this certification fairly quickly<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: center;\">CMA (Certified Management Accountant)<\/h3>\n<p>The CMA certification is granted by the Institute of Management Accountants (IMA) and is primarily focused on management accounting and financial management.
